ClampJS中文文档,如何全面掌握并有效应用?

clamp.js是一个用于JavaScript的库,提供中文文档支持。

关于clampjs的中文文档,由于直接访问外部链接可能受限,以下内容基于一般知识与假设构建,旨在提供一个结构化且详细的概览:

ClampJS中文文档,如何全面掌握并有效应用?

clampjs中文文档

目录

简介

安装与配置

核心功能

数据绑定

指令系统

组件化开发

高级特性

状态管理

路由管理

常见问题与解答

版本更新日志

一、简介

ClampJS是一款轻量级的前端JavaScript框架,专注于提供高效、简洁的数据绑定和组件化开发能力,适用于构建现代Web应用,其设计理念是保持核心库的轻量化,同时通过丰富的插件机制满足不同项目的需求。

ClampJS中文文档,如何全面掌握并有效应用?

二、安装与配置

1. 安装方式

npm安装:npm install clampjs

CDN引入: 通过[官方CDN链接](https://cdn.example.com/clampjs)直接在HTML中引用。

2. 快速开始

<!DOCTYPE html>
<html>
<head>
    <title>ClampJS Example</title>
    <script src="path/to/clampjs.min.js"></script>
</head>
<body>
    <div id="app">{message}</div>
    <script>
        const app = new Clamp({
            el: '#app',
            data: {
                message: 'Hello, ClampJS!'
            }
        });
    </script>
</body>
</html>

三、核心功能

1. 数据绑定

ClampJS采用基于HTML属性的数据绑定机制,支持单向和双向绑定,确保数据与视图的同步。

2. 指令系统

提供如v-ifv-forv-bind等常用指令,简化模板编写,提升开发效率。

3. 组件化开发

支持组件化开发,允许开发者定义可复用的组件,促进代码组织和维护。

四、高级特性

1. 状态管理

虽然ClampJS本身未内置全局状态管理解决方案,但可通过插件或结合其他库(如Redux)实现。

2. 路由管理

ClampJS中文文档,如何全面掌握并有效应用?

同样,ClampJS不直接提供路由管理,推荐使用专业路由库配合使用。

五、常见问题与解答

1、Q: ClampJS与Vue.js有何区别?

A: ClampJS更注重轻量化和灵活性,适合简单到中等复杂度的应用,而Vue.js功能更全面,生态系统更成熟。

2、Q: 如何进行模块化开发?

A: 推荐使用Webpack或Rollup等模块打包工具,结合ClampJS的组件系统进行模块化开发。

六、版本更新日志

v1.0.0: 初始版本,包含基础的数据绑定和组件系统。

v1.1.0: 增加多项性能优化,提升渲染速度。

: 后续版本持续增加新特性和改进。

为示例性质,具体细节请参考[ClampJS官方文档](http://clampjs.org/docs)获取最新最准确的信息。

到此,以上就是小编对于“clampjs中文文档”的问题就介绍到这了,希望介绍的几点解答对大家有用,有任何问题和不懂的,欢迎各位朋友在评论区讨论,给我留言。

文章来源网络,作者:运维,如若转载,请注明出处:https://shuyeidc.com/wp/46972.html<

(0)
运维的头像运维
上一篇2025-01-05 17:13
下一篇 2025-01-05 17:20

相关推荐

  • 如何使用JavaScript在CMS中渲染前端页面?

    CMS(内容管理系统)可以使用JavaScript来渲染前端页面,通过动态加载和更新内容,提升用户体验。

    2025-01-27
    0
  • ASP市省的发展现状如何?

    ASP市省是一个虚构的概念,现实中并不存在这样的行政区划。如果你需要关于某个具体城市或省份的信息,请提供真实的地名,我会尽力为你提供相关信息。

    2025-01-26
    0
  • 如何设计一个高效的ASP商品详情页?

    ASP商品详情页展示了商品的详细信息,包括名称、价格、图片和描述。用户可在此页面了解商品的具体信息,并决定是否购买。

    2025-01-19
    0
  • ASP占位符是什么?它在编程中有什么作用?

    当然可以,但您提供的内容似乎不完整或存在误解。您提到的“asp占位符”,可能需要进一步明确是指ASP(Active Server Pages)编程中的某种特定用法、概念,还是与ASP相关的其他技术细节。,,如果您能详细描述一下您希望了解的具体内容或者问题,我将很乐意为您提供更准确、详尽的回答。您是否想了解ASP中如何定义和使用占位符、占位符在数据处理中的作用,或者是关于ASP占位符的其他特定主题?请提供更多信息,我会竭力帮助您。

    2025-01-07
    0
  • 如何利用JS实现高效且吸引人的产品展示效果?

    当然,以下是一段关于产品展示的JavaScript代码示例:,,“javascript,// 假设我们有一个产品数组,const products = [, { id: 1, name: ‘产品A’, price: 100 },, { id: 2, name: ‘产品B’, price: 200 },, { id: 3, name: ‘产品C’, price: 300 },];,,// 获取展示产品的容器,const productContainer = document.getElementById(‘product-container’);,,// 遍历产品数组并生成HTML内容,products.forEach(product =˃ {, const productElement = document.createElement(‘div’);, productElement.className = ‘product’;, productElement.innerHTML = ,${product.name},价格: ${product.price}元, ;, productContainer.appendChild(productElement);,});,“,,这段代码会将产品信息动态添加到页面上的一个容器中。

    2024-12-07
    0

发表回复

您的邮箱地址不会被公开。必填项已用 * 标注